Definitions

honeycomb
Noun
raiting
A structure of hexagonal cells of wax, made by bees to store honey and eggs.
The beekeeper carefully extracted the honeycomb from the hive.
A pattern or structure resembling a honeycomb, especially in being porous or having a network of holes.
The architect designed the building with a honeycomb facade to improve ventilation.
honeycomb
Verb
raiting
To fill with cavities or tunnels, resembling a honeycomb structure.
The old building was honeycombed with secret passages and hidden rooms.
To penetrate or undermine thoroughly, often in a way that weakens the structure.
The termites had honeycombed the wooden beams, making the house unsafe.
